The ingredients needed to make Dhania and turmeric chapatis:
- Make ready 3 cups all purpose flour
- Make ready 1 bunch dhania, finely chopped
- Prepare 1 tbsp turmeric powder
- Take 6 tbsp vegetable oil + more fore cooking
- Make ready 1 cup warm water
- Take to taste Salt and sugar

Instructions to make Dhania and turmeric chapatis:
- In a large mixing bowl, add in all the ingridients and knead to a nice dough
- Cover and let rest for at least 15 minutes
- Dust your work surface and roll out the dough
- Smear some vegetable oil evenly and cut the dough into strips
- Roll the strips to a pinwheel
- Roll each pinwheel to a circular shape
- In a heated pan, cook the dough shapes, adding oil on both sides until it gets some golden brown patches
- Place them in an Underlined container and cover
- Serve hot with your desired stew…ENJOY!!!
